class SemanticVersion(Object):
def __init__(self, stringVersion):
self.major = 0
self.minor = 0
self.patch = 0
self.preRelease = None
self.parse(stringVersion)
def parse(self, stringVersion):
import re
pattern = re.compile(r"(\d+)(\.(\d+)((\.)(\d+))?)?(-([a-zA-Z0-9]+))?")
def toInt(s):
try:
return int(s)
except:
return 0
result = pattern.match(stringVersion)
if result is None:
raise Exception("Invalid version string: '{0}'".format(stringVersion))
self.major = toInt(result.group(1))
self.minor = toInt(result.group(3))
self.patch = toInt(result.group(6))
self.preRelease = result.group(8)
def compare_semver(currentVersion, candidateVersion):
"""
returns negative if current version is bigger, 0 if versions are equal and positive if candidateVersion is higher.
e.g.
1.0, 1.1 -> 1
1.0, 1.0-beta -> -1
"""
currentVersion = SemanticVersion(currentVersion)
candidateVersion = SemanticVersion(candidateVersion)
if currentVersion.major != candidateVersion.major:
return candidateVersion.major - currentVersion.major
if currentVersion.minor != candidateVersion.minor:
return candidateVersion.minor - currentVersion.minor
if currentVersion.patch != candidateVersion.patch:
return candidateVersion.patch - currentVersion.patch
if currentVersion.preRelease != candidateVersion.preRelease:
if currentVersion.preRelease is None:
return -1
if candidateVersion.preRelease is None:
return 1
return 1 if candidateVersion.preRelease > currentVersion.preRelease else -1
return 0
